After cutting up raw chicken, it is important to wash the cutting board, knife, and hands thoroughly with soap and water to prevent the spread of bacteria.
Explanation:
When handling raw chicken, it is important to take proper precautions to prevent foodborne illnesses. After cutting up the raw chicken, you should wash the cutting board and knife with soap and hot water to remove any bacteria. Wiping them with a sanitizer wipe cloth may not be enough to ensure proper sanitation. Additionally, it is crucial to wash your hands thoroughly with soap and water, rather than just using a sanitizer wipe cloth.
